This Canadian-American actor gained recognition through roles in popular television series and films. He portrayed Matty McKibben in 'Awkward', a series that aired from 2011 to 2016, which followed the life of a high school girl facing various challenges. Additionally, he appeared in the horror film 'The Last House on the Left' released in 2009. Mirchoff has also featured in other series and movies, showcasing his range as an actor.

Shonda Rhimes

Television producer and screenwriter
Born
January 13th, 1970 55 years ago

Produced and created several popular television series. 'Grey's Anatomy' garnered critical acclaim and established a significant fan base. 'Scandal' became a cultural phenomenon, exploring political drama. 'How to Get Away with Murder' received multiple award nominations, showcasing complex legal issues. Founded Shondaland, a production company that focuses on inclusive storytelling in television.

Orlando Bloom

English actor known for 'The Lord of the Rings'
Born
January 13th, 1977 48 years ago

An English actor rose to prominence through roles in blockbuster films. Gained recognition starring as Legolas in 'The Lord of the Rings' trilogy, which included 'The Fellowship of the Ring', 'The Two Towers', and 'The Return of the King'. Also played the character Will Turner in the 'Pirates of the Caribbean' series, starting with 'The Curse of the Black Pearl'. Other notable roles included performances in 'Troy' and 'Elizabethtown'. His career featured a blend of action, fantasy, and drama genres, leading to various award nominations.

Paul Feyerabend

Philosopher and academic with Against Method
Born
January 13th, 1924 101 years ago
Died
February 11th, 1994 31 years ago — 70 years old

Born in Austria, contributed significantly to the philosophy of science. Advocated for a pluralistic approach to scientific practices, challenging the idea of a universal scientific method. Gained prominence through the publication of 'Against Method,' which critiqued the rigidity of traditional scientific methodologies. Worked at various academic institutions across Europe and the United States, influencing debates on scientific epistemology and the relationship between science and society.
